Acclaimed Martinican filmmaker Euzhan Palcy will be visiting the Wexner Center for the Arts from September 22nd, 2025 through September 26th. Through her illustrious career in television and film, Palcy has highlighted issues of race and gender in the lasting legacy of colonialism, which has led to numerous distinctions and global recognition for her work. 

While at the Wexner Center, Palcy will introduce screenings of her films Sugar Cane Alley (1983) and A Dry White Season (1989). More information can be found on the Wexner Center for the Arts webpage, linked below, as well as the informational flyer attached to this posting.
